health systems - French English Dictionary

health systems

Play ENFRENus
Play ENFRENuk
Play ENFRENau

Meanings of "health systems" in French English Dictionary : 1 result(s)

English French
Medicine
health systems systèmes relatifs à la santé

Meanings of "health systems" with other terms in English French Dictionary : 6 result(s)

English French
Humanitarians
health information systems systèmes d'ınformation de santé
Health Research
global health policy and systems research (ghpsr) recherche sur les politiques et les systèmes de santé dans le monde (rpssm) [f]
research on health care systems and services recherche sur les systèmes et les services de santé [f]
health policy and systems management research recherche sur la gestion des systèmes et la politique de la santé
Psychology
smart systems for health systèmes intelligents pour la santé
health systems research and consulting unit unité de conseil et de recherche sur les systèmes de santé